Type
ORACLE
Validation date
2024-10-05 04:51: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01206,
    "usd": 0.01324
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001F697BEDE491A3EBD542BE37F761218B2CD52A985CEC5C06FCE5C1F23207AAF49

Previous signature

A4B44D6207D219B055B986CCD56F0DB716AECB1C8F294CA00AC5C4C4DA48B6F77E119EFC3DF8B0FD0C6836DEB29A8EDEA0ACAE555F9A84C45896CB9BA3CE9C01

Origin signature

3046022100A601E09C37F1CBA8C3727FA391602C2538CE2C30077E6A2788044DF8741E12E30221008F88C0F3669E886A4E4BF6B99F4E2FB4DBD5771EEEF230FE6003885548A9AE12

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

00FEC12729264384C6A117D3DA61F3C463687EE6631CA0F6D72C45AE1499EF547F

Coordinator signature

C9765CBB27C710735E70DEE66057F536AE01E7E77E0D6E597185C3AF91B3AE0BAB1E041C237B8FF98A22F294DD863C4B1B82C38CAD09E122FB70CA8014510C06

Validator #1 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#1 signature

FF9E089A3AB17864E82A1B2673B5ED517B70BD4B5DF9A80EA4CC03CE4B27CDA47D0E7E670F12470F2B261B5FF4411797DE332A8701D43B4FEA16885CE3FBD50A

Validator #2 public key

0001E6A3BEAAF28031AE2072301E3083DF3DDBA10A2CAAD30163F01D007BA76A122D

Validator #2 signature

45B173111C0CC751581916B564244AD2407CD78DE1C02AC2F4BAF36A74D1ECAB0BEA8770EBCEBCFB3FE771BC87DD5086025F4E54CEF3861C31BD6417F7420F01